Ever wondered if tiny creatures have secrets of their own? Meet Megalorchestia, commonly known as beach hoppers. These crustaceans are part of the amphipod family and thrive along sandy shores. Seen mostly when the tide goes out, they become little jumping enthusiasts on the beach. Native to the Pacific coast of North America, these unique critters were first spotted in the late 19th century. They've adapted surprisingly well to their often harsh environments, and they’ve got stories to tell—if only they could speak.
Megalorchestia play a crucial role in the beach ecosystem. They primarily help in breaking down plant material like seaweed through their munching. The significance of these small yet mighty creatures cannot be overstated. By aiding in decomposition, they contribute massively to nutrient cycling, thus keeping their habitat healthy. Despite the hurdles they face, Megalorchestia adapt in fascinating ways. They time their activities to avoid both high tides and intense sunlight, hopping about in the twilight hours—truly the introverts of the animal kingdom. They burrow into moist sand to stave off dehydration during daylight, showing a remarkable capability to adjust to their ever-changing environment.
